There are numerous reasons for water leakages, and also we have actually put together the common factors listed below. Check to see if you have had associated concerns in your house just recently.
Clogged drains
Food fragments, dust, and grease can trigger clogged up drains pipes and also block the passage of water in and out of your sink. Enhanced stress within the gutters can cause an overflow as well as end up cracking or bursting pipelines if undealt with. To stay clear of stopped up drains pipes in your home, we advise you to avoid putting bits away and also routine cleansing of sinks.
High water pressure
You saw your home water stress is greater than normal but after that, why should you care? It runs out your control.
It would be best if you cared due to the fact that your average water pressure should be 60 Psi (per square inch) as well as although your residence's plumbing system is created to hold up against 80 Psi. A rise in water pressure can put a stress on your house pipelines and lead to cracks, or worse, ruptured pipes. Get in touch with a professional concerning regulating it if you ever before observe that your residence water stress is greater than typical.
Corrosion
As your pipework grows older, it gets weaker and also much more prone to corrosion after the constant flow of water through them, which can eat away at pipelines and also trigger splits. A visible indicator of corrosion in your home plumbing system is discoloration and although this might be hard to discover because of most pipes hidden away. Once they are old to ensure an audio plumbing system, we advise doing a regular check-up every couple of years as well as alter pipelines
Damaged pipeline joints
Pipe joints are the parts of our plumbing system where the pipelines connect. They are the weakest factor of our plumbing system. Consequently, they are much more prone to damage. It is important to keep in mind that even though pipelines are designed to hold up against stress and also last for some time, they weren't created to last permanently; as a result, they would certainly weaken in time. This wear and tear might lead to splits in plumbing systems. A typical sign of harmed pipeline joints is excessive sound from taps.
Busted seals
Another source of water leaks in houses is damaged seals of home devices that utilize water, e.g., a dishwashing machine. When such appliances are set up, seals are installed around water ports for simple flow of water through the device. Hence, a busted seal can cause leakage of water when being used.

WHAT ARE THE COMMON PLACES TO DETECT WATER LEAKS?
There’s no need to panic if you don’t own a leak-detecting tool. There are still some effective traditional techniques for detecting a water leak in your house. We’ve discussed some common spots in your house where leaks are most likely to occur throughout this section. Let’s take a look!
BOILER OR WATER TANK
Your boiler or water tank valves are pretty prone to water leakage. So, check the boiler valves, and you might be able to detect the leak. But, if there’s no water escaping from the valves, you might have a slow leak. Thus, look for water spots on the floor or try to detect any hissing sound coming from the valves.
However, if you own a central healing water boiler, the leak can indicate some severe water damage. Under such circumstances, don’t try to fix the leak yourself; contact a professional as soon as possible.
TOILETS
Considering how frequently we use toilets, having a leaky toilet is quite common. Fixing a minor water leak is pretty straightforward, and you can do it yourself without hiring professional help. For instance, changing the washer or improving the drainage pipe usually doesn’t require guidance from a professional plumber.
However, if you ignore a toilet leak or fail to detect it in time, it can overflow the toilet, causing severe property damage. Thus, if the situation is dire, it’s best to hire emergency plumbing services and get the water leak in your toilet fixed immediately.
SHOWERHEADS
Like toilets, showerheads are frequently used and are more prone to water leakage. Old showerheads wear down over time, leading to leaking shower pipes. You can detect such leaks by the drop in the water pressure of the showerheads.
You can clean your showerhead or if that doesn’t work, replace the pipe supplying water to the showerhead with a new pipe. It’s pretty straightforward, so you might not need to hire professional plumbers.
